Shoulder Innovations (NYSE:SIG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, March 10th. The company reported ($0.38)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of ($0.42) by $0.04. The business had revenue of $14.42 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$12.69 million. Shoulder Innovations had a negative return on equity of 37.68% and a negative net margin of 85.29%.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Shoulder Innovations will post -1.71 EPS for the current year.

Shoulder Innovations (NYSE:SI) is a medical device company focused on the design, development and commercialization of shoulder implant systems and related surgical instruments for orthopedic surgery. The company’s product portfolio includes modular shoulder prostheses, humeral and glenoid components, and instrumentation kits designed to facilitate both primary and revision shoulder arthroplasty procedures. Emphasizing a patient-centric approach, Shoulder Innovations works to offer implant solutions that aim to restore mobility and reduce post-operative complications.

In addition to its core implant offerings, Shoulder Innovations provides comprehensive clinical support and training programs for surgeons and operating room teams.
